<script type="text/javascript">
function ziji()
{
var obj=document.getElementsByTagName("checkbox");
for(i=0;i<obj.length;i++)
{
document.obj[i].disabled=true;
}
}
</script>
<INPUT type=checkbox name=peizhi[] value="1">
<INPUT type=checkbox name=peizhi[] value="2">
<INPUT type=checkbox name=peizhi[] value="3">
<INPUT type=checkbox name=peizhi[] value="4">
<INPUT type=checkbox name=peizhi[] value="5">
<INPUT type=checkbox name=peizhi[] value="6">
<INPUT type=checkbox name=peizhi[] value="7"><input type=Button onClick="ziji()" value="只读" />
这个无法达到效果,哪里错了吗
解决方案 »
- 使用js实现带有时间的日期选择器
- |zyciis| 如何在Jquery Ajax中的ajaxStart停止当前Ajax的提交 谢谢
- web页面控件的详细测试用例,
- 请问如何动态改变循环语句
- javascript如何读取xml,我这段代码在IE下正常,但在firefox,netscape不正常
- 请问像BTCHINA的鼠标悬浮层怎么做?
- javascript怎么实现打开/保存文件对话框?
- 如何关闭点击链接时发出的声音?
- 在frame中页面刷新问题,急!
- 用window.print打印的时候怎样能直接控制打印机的设置是用A5的纸,并且页眉和页脚都去掉?
- escape sequence和properties of an object
- 关于移动表格行的问题
function ziji() {
var obj = document.getElementsByTagName("input");
for (i = 0, count = obj.length; i < count; i++) {
if(obj[i].type == 'checkbox') obj[i].disabled = true;
}
}
function ziji()
{
var obj=document.getElementsByName("peizhi[]");
for(i=0;i<obj.length;i++)
{
obj[i].disabled=true;
}
}
</script>
<INPUT type=checkbox name=peizhi[] value="1">
<INPUT type=checkbox name=peizhi[] value="2">
<INPUT type=checkbox name=peizhi[] value="3">
<INPUT type=checkbox name=peizhi[] value="4">
<INPUT type=checkbox name=peizhi[] value="5">
<INPUT type=checkbox name=peizhi[] value="6">
<INPUT type=checkbox name=peizhi[] value="7"><input type=Button onClick="ziji()" value="只读" />
</body>
<script type="text/javascript">
function ziji()
{
var obj=document.getElementsByName("peizhi");
for(i=0;i<obj.length;i++)
{
obj[i].disabled=true;
}
}
</script>
<INPUT type=checkbox name=peizhi value="1">
<INPUT type=checkbox name=peizhi value="2">
<INPUT type=checkbox name=peizhi value="3">
<INPUT type=checkbox name=peizhi value="4">
<INPUT type=checkbox name=peizhi value="5">
<INPUT type=checkbox name=peizhi value="6">
<INPUT type=checkbox name=peizhi value="7"><input type=Button onClick="ziji()" value="只读" />
disabled = "true"
这两个都可以。
{
document.obj[i].disabled=true; //改为obj[i].disabled=true;
}
for(i=0;i<obj.length;i++)
{
obj[i].disabled=true;
}
for(i=0;i <obj.length;i++)
{
obj[i].disabled=true;
}
function ziji()
{
var obj=document.getElementsByName("peizhi[]");
for(i=0;i<obj.length;i++)
{
obj[i].onclick=function(evt){var o = window.event?window.event.srcElement:evt.target;o.checked=!o.checked}
}
}
</script>
<INPUT type=checkbox name=peizhi[] value="1">
<INPUT type=checkbox name=peizhi[] value="2">
<INPUT type=checkbox name=peizhi[] value="3">
<INPUT type=checkbox name=peizhi[] value="4">
<INPUT type=checkbox name=peizhi[] value="5" checked="checked">
<INPUT type=checkbox name=peizhi[] value="6">
<INPUT type=checkbox name=peizhi[] value="7"><input type=Button onClick="ziji()" value="只读" />
使用disabled,那么,如果默认有选项选择的话,则不能提交了
function ziji()
{
var obj=document.getElementsByTagName("input");
for(i=0;i<obj.length;i++)
{
if(obj[i].type=="checkbox")
{
obj[i].disabled=true;
}
}
}
</script>
<INPUT type=checkbox name=peizhi[] value="1">
<INPUT type=checkbox name=peizhi[] value="2">
<INPUT type=checkbox name=peizhi[] value="3">
<INPUT type=checkbox name=peizhi[] value="4">
<INPUT type=checkbox name=peizhi[] value="5">
<INPUT type=checkbox name=peizhi[] value="6">
<INPUT type=checkbox name=peizhi[] value="7"><input type=Button onClick="ziji()" value="只读" />这个就对了